Jake is comparing the prices of two mattress cleaning companies. Company A charges $30 per mattress and an additional $13 as service charges. Company B charges $28 per mattress and an additional $15 as service charges. Part A: Write equations to represent Company A and Company B's total mattress cleaning charges for a certain number of mattresses. Define the variable used in the equations. Part B: Which company would charge less for cleaning 4 mattresses? Justify your answer. Part C: How much money is saved by using the services of Company B instead of Company A to cle

Let N be the number of mattresses to be cleaned and C be the total cost. For company A: C = 30N + 13 For company B: C = 28N + 15

OpenStudy (ranga):

For cleaning 4 mattresses, put N = 4 Company A: C = 30 * 4 + 13 = $133 Company B: C = 28 * 4 + 15 = $127 Therefore, for cleaning 4 mattresses, Company B will charge less.

OpenStudy (ranga):

For part C, put N = 7 and calculate the total cost with Company A and Company B and find the difference.
